An excellent and unique opportunity to acquire approx. 40.66 acres of land total. The Property consists of two lots, available separately or as a whole:

Lot 1: Loundsley Green Development Site - Guide Price: £750,000
A prime development site of approx. 2.63 acres edged red on the Site Plan. It is currently grassland and has the benefit of detailed planning consent for 13 detached houses (as shown on the Site Layout Plan) subject to conditions.

Lot 2: Ashgate Plantation - Guide Price: £200,000
A mature woodland of approx. 38.03 acres edged green on the Site Plan. It neighbours the development site and excludes the active telecommunication masts shown on the Site Plan. The sale of the Plantation to be subject to a 10 year Management Plan for the benefit of Lot 1 the cost of which is to be borne by the buyer of Lot 1.

Location
The property is in the Loundsley Green and Ashgate area on the western edge of Chesterfield, approx. 2km from the town centre. The development site and adjoining woodland have excellent access to both the countryside and amenities of Chesterfield. Access to the site is from Loundsley Green Road (B6150), while Ashgate Plantation has access from both Loundsley Green Road and Ashgate Road.

Overage
The sale of the woodland will be subject to an overage clause of 33% of any uplift in value (including that of associated amenity use) from that of existing woodland use for a period of 25 years.

Planning
Copies of the Planning Consent are available along with copies of the documents used for the planning application on request and can be viewed on Chesterfield Borough Council Planning Portal with references che/15/00835, che/19/00093/rem (reserved matters approval) and che/19/00643/DOC (discharge of conditions).

The reports are provided to prospective purchasers for information only to assist in making offers, however intended purchasers still need to corroborate the findings and carry out their own investigations as deemed necessary.

Ashgate Plantation has been designated as a Local Wildlife Site and a management scheme has been carried out to thin the woodland. Whilst the woodland is subject to Tree Protection Orders there is an opportunity for it to compliment a residential development as amenity outdoor space and biodiversity net gain.

Rights of Way, Wayleaves and Easements
There are rights of access from Ashgate Road to the two telecommunication masts situated on the edge of the plantation (which are excluded from the sale).

There is a public footpath along the eastern border of the development site. There are no formal rights of way over Ashgate Plantation.

Tenure and Method of Sale
The land is being sold freehold with vacant possession by private treaty.

Tree Preservation Orders
The land is subject to the following Tree Preservation Orders:
Chesterfield Borough Council Tree Preservation Order 4901.64 reference W1 Ashgate Plantation (1969).
Derbyshire County Council Tree Preservation Order No 52 reference W1.

Sporting, Timber and Mineral Rights
All sporting, timber and mineral rights owned by the vendor are included in the sale.
